Trim Height (Wishbone Suspension Only)
Adjustment
Adjust the trim height by means of adjusting bolt on the
height control arms.
Caution:
When adjusting front end alignment, be sure to begin
with trim height as trim height adjustment may change
other adjusted alignments.
1. Check and adjust the tire inflation pressures.
2. Park the vehicle on a level ground and move the
front of the vehicle up and down several times to
settle the suspension.
3. Make necessary adjustment with the adjusting bolt
on the height control arms.
Trim Height
101.4
±5 mm (3.992±0.197 in)
Measurement of Side Slippage
When inspection and adjustments of toe-in, camber,
caster and king pin inclination are completed, check for
side slippage using a side slip tester.
Roll the wheels over the side slip tester as slowly as
possible and take reading on the tester. If the amount of
side slippage is in excess of 5 mm per 1 m, recheck the
wheel alignment.
Side Slippage
Limit: 5.0 mm (0.197 in) Per 1m
